Nigeria’s Seplat hits first gas at ANOH plant, marking milestone for Africa’s gas ambitions

  • Seplat starts first gas at 300 MMcfd ANOH processing plant
  • Project supports Nigeria’s gas monetisation and flaring reduction goals

 

ABUJA, NIGERIA – Seplat Energy Plc has achieved first gas production at its 300 million standard cubic feet per day ANOH Gas Processing Company, a major milestone for Nigeria’s gas sector.

Seplat said the breakthrough followed completion of the 11-kilometre Indorama gas export pipeline and receipt of regulatory approval from the Nigerian Upstream Petroleum Regulatory Commission.
